一、环境准备与安装
1. 手动安装【Python、Node、Git】
1.1 安装 Python
下载并安装 Python 3.11.x 版本。安装时勾选 "Add python.exe to PATH"。
验证安装:
py --version
注意:Windows 自带的「Python 快捷方式」可能拦截命令。建议使用
py命令替代,后续所有 Python 命令均使用py执行。
1.2 克隆项目
git clone https://github.com/TencentOpen/OpenClaw.git
若网络受限,可能需要配置代理或镜像。
2. 一键脚本安装【PowerShell】
适合 Windows 用户,脚本可自动处理依赖、镜像及权限问题。
2.1 清理残留(可选)
若之前安装失败,建议先清理缓存和进程:
# 强制停止相关进程
taskkill /f /im node.exe 2>$null
taskkill /f /im openclaw-cn.exe 2>$null
# 卸载旧版本
npm uninstall -g openclaw 2>$null
npm uninstall -g clawd 2>$null
# 清理全局缓存
npm cache clean --force
npm cache verify
# 删除本地残留配置
Remove-Item -Path "$env:USERPROFILE\.openclaw" -Recurse -Force -ErrorAction SilentlyContinue
Remove-Item -Path "$env:USERPROFILE\AppData\Roaming\npm\node_modules\openclaw" -Recurse -Force -ErrorAction SilentlyContinue
Write-Host "✅ 所有旧缓存、残留、失败安装包 已全部清空!"
2.2 执行安装
运行官方提供的 PowerShell 脚本:
$ProgressPreference = 'Continue'
iwr -useb https://clawd.org.cn/install.ps1 | iex
执行后需等待下载完成,时间视网络情况而定。
二、模型配置与环境初始化
安装完成后,需完善本地配置以启动服务。
1. AI 模型配置
需要获取以下信息:API Key、API 地址、模型 ID。确保四者同时满足且可用。
2. 初始化向导
重新执行或继续运行以下命令进入配置页面:
openclaw-cn onboard
按提示完成以下步骤:
- 确认安全风险并继续。
- 完成初始化配置(运行模式、模型设置、网关配置)。
- 生成配置文件。
- 启动网关。
- 验证启动状态。
三、常见问题排查
1. 网关异常
重启后网关异常关闭,或无法在浏览器中检测。
- 检查端口占用情况。
- 查看日志输出是否有报错信息。
2. 模型未配置
浏览器与 AI 对话无响应,数据源缺失。
- 确认模型 API 配置是否正确。

